The superior gluteal artery supplies blood to the gluteal muscles gluteus maximus gluteus medius gluteus minimus the tensor fasciae latae the piriformis and to the hip joint. This artery usually exits the pelvis by passing between the S1 and S2 or the S2 and S3 ventral rami. It leaves the pelvic cavity via the greater sciatic foramen emerging inferiorly to the piriformis muscle in the gluteal region.

Arteria glutaea inferior is a branch of the anterior trunk of the internal iliac artery. The superficial branch gives off several branches that contribute to the blood supply to the gluteus maximus muscle by forming several anastomoses with the branches of the inferior gluteal artery. Via these anastomoses the branches of the superior gluteal artery provide about one-third of the blood supply to the gluteus maximus although sometimes it can be its main supplying vessel.

The inferior gluteal artery is the smaller of the two main artery branches that stem off the internal iliac artery which supplies blood to the entire gluteal region. The inferior gluteal artery passes downward between the second and the third sacral segments on the sacral plexus.
